I was wondering what the status of support for Nokia Series 60 phones such as 
my shiny new 7610 is? As far as I can tell, it isn't supported by gnokii as 
yet. I don't mind mucking in and writing some code, but I thought I'd ask 
about it before trying to reinvent the wheel.

It is connected via a DKU-2 usb cable, and I've installed the usb-serial 
kernel module, and it is found. A device is made in devfs at /dev/usb/tts/0, 
but I at this stage I am stuck. I've tried getting a number of tools to talk 
to it, but all to no avail.
